Understanding TikTok Stories

Before diving into the removal process, it's helpful to understand how TikTok stories work. Unlike regular TikTok videos, which remain on your profile indefinitely unless deleted, stories disappear after 24 hours. This ephemeral nature is part of their appeal, but it doesn't mean you're stuck with a story you regret. You have complete control over your story's lifespan.

How to Remove a TikTok Story: A Step-by-Step Guide

Here's how to remove a TikTok story before it automatically expires:

  1. Open the TikTok app: Launch the TikTok app on your phone.

  2. Navigate to your story: Tap on your profile picture in the bottom right corner to go to your profile. You'll usually see your story displayed prominently at the top of your profile, if you have one currently active.

  3. Access your story: Tap on your story to open it.

  4. Locate the delete option: While viewing your story, look for a three-dot menu (usually located in the bottom right corner).

  5. Select "Delete": Tap the three-dot menu and you should see a "Delete" option. Select it to confirm your choice.

  6. Confirmation: TikTok will often ask for a confirmation to prevent accidental deletions. Confirm your decision to delete the story.

Troubleshooting: What if I can't find the delete option?

Sometimes, the interface might vary slightly depending on your app version. If you can't find the "Delete" option immediately:

  • Update your app: Ensure your TikTok app is up-to-date. Outdated versions can sometimes have missing features or bugs.

  • Restart your device: A simple restart can often resolve minor glitches that may interfere with the app's functionality.

  • Check your internet connection: A poor or unstable internet connection can sometimes prevent certain actions within the app.
